Abstract

本发明公开了一种防漏耕开沟器,主要包括开沟器机架、动力输入轴、第一开沟链轮、开沟链条、第一开沟刀片和第二开沟刀片。本发明通过动力输入轴带动第一开沟链轮转动,使安装在第一开沟链轮两侧的第一开沟刀片转动,对位于开沟器两边的土壤进行开沟。在位于开沟器中部的开沟链条上安装有第二开沟刀片,第二开沟刀片采用链式开沟刀片,间隔地安装在开沟链条上,对开沟器中部进行开沟作业,从而避免漏耕的情况出现。另外,本发明还在第一开沟链轮的上方设置第二开沟链轮,将刀盘装置设计成可拆卸的部件,当需要开阶梯沟时,将刀盘装置拆下来安装在第二开沟链轮上即可,操作十分方便。本发明的结构简单、制造成本较低,而且可以实现一机多用。

The invention discloses a leak-proof tillage ditch opener, which mainly includes a ditch opener frame, a power input shaft, a first ditch sprocket, a ditch chain, a first ditch blade and a second ditch blade. The invention drives the first ditching sprocket to rotate through the power input shaft, so that the first ditching blades installed on both sides of the first ditching sprocket rotate to ditch the soil on both sides of the ditching device. A second ditching blade is installed on the ditching chain located in the middle of the ditching device, and the second ditching blade adopts a chain type ditching blade, which is installed on the ditching chain at intervals to carry out ditching operation on the middle part of the ditching device. Thereby avoiding the occurrence of missing tillage. In addition, the present invention also sets the second ditching sprocket above the first ditching sprocket, and the cutter head device is designed as a detachable part. It can be installed on the ditch sprocket, and the operation is very convenient. The invention has simple structure, low manufacturing cost, and can realize multiple functions of one machine.

背景技术Background technique

开沟机广泛应用于工程、农业等需要开挖沟槽的领域。农业机械化发展对施肥机械要求不断提高,开沟施肥机被广泛采用为施肥机械,一般先用开沟机开出一定深度和宽度的沟槽,施入肥料后再覆土。开沟器是开沟施肥机主要工作部件,现有旋转式开沟器如图2所示,由于采用中间传动的方式驱动两边的刀片,中间部分的传动结构占据一定宽度,两边的刀片无法触及,从而形成一条漏耕地带,导致漏耕问题,影响开沟的质量。Trench machines are widely used in engineering, agriculture and other fields that need to dig trenches. The development of agricultural mechanization has continuously improved the requirements for fertilizing machinery. Ditching and fertilizing machines are widely used as fertilizing machines. Generally, a ditching machine is used to open a trench of a certain depth and width, and then the fertilizer is applied and then covered with soil. The ditch opener is the main working part of the ditching and fertilizing machine. The existing rotary ditch opener is shown in Figure 2. Because the middle transmission is used to drive the blades on both sides, the transmission structure of the middle part occupies a certain width, and the blades on both sides cannot be touched. , thus forming a zone of missed tillage, leading to the problem of missed tillage and affecting the quality of ditching.

发明内容Contents of the invention

本发明的目的在于克服现有技术的不足,提供一种结构简单、成本低、,又具有调整开沟刀安装位置后,可开阶梯形沟功能的防漏耕开沟器。The purpose of the present invention is to overcome the deficiencies of the prior art and provide a leak-proof tillage opener with simple structure, low cost, and the function of opening stepped trenches after adjusting the installation position of the trencher.

本发明的目的通过下述技术方案实现:The object of the present invention is achieved through the following technical solutions:

一种防漏耕开沟器,主要包括开沟器机架、用于输入动力的动力输入轴、用于开沟的第一开沟链轮、连接动力输入轴和第一开沟链轮的开沟链条、第一开沟刀片和第二开沟刀片。所述动力输入轴设置在开沟器机架的上端,其上还设有用于连接第一开沟链轮的第一主动链轮和用于连接第二开沟链轮的第二主动链轮。第一开沟链轮位于开沟器机架的下端,通过开沟链条与动力输入轴传动连接,具体的,开沟链条分别连接第一主动链轮和第一开沟链轮上,当动力输入轴转动时,通过开沟链条直接带动第一开沟链轮转动。所述第一开沟刀片分别安装在第一开沟链轮的两端,与第一开沟链轮传动连接,对两边的土壤进行开沟。所述第二开沟刀片安装在开沟链条上,通过开沟链条的转动,带动第二开沟刀片对中间部分的土壤进行开沟作业,开沟链条既作为传动链条,也作为开沟工作时的开沟链条,这样设计可以把开沟机经过的土地都开好沟槽,有效解决了传统开沟器漏耕的问题。A leak-proof tillage ditch opener mainly includes a ditch opener frame, a power input shaft for inputting power, a first ditching sprocket for ditching, and a sprocket connecting the power input shaft and the first ditching sprocket. Ditching chain, first ditching blade and second ditching blade. The power input shaft is arranged on the upper end of the ditch opener frame, on which there are also a first driving sprocket for connecting the first ditching sprocket and a second driving sprocket for connecting the second ditching sprocket . The first ditching sprocket is located at the lower end of the opener frame, and is connected to the power input shaft through a ditching chain. Specifically, the ditching chain is respectively connected to the first driving sprocket and the first ditching sprocket. When the power When the input shaft rotates, the ditching chain directly drives the first ditching sprocket to rotate. The first ditching blades are respectively installed at both ends of the first ditching sprocket, and are connected in transmission with the first ditching sprocket to ditch the soil on both sides. The second ditching blade is installed on the ditching chain, and through the rotation of the ditching chain, the second ditching blade is driven to perform ditching operation on the middle part of the soil, and the ditching chain is used as both a transmission chain and a ditching work Timely ditching chain, this design can ditch the land that the ditcher passes through, effectively solving the problem of traditional ditchers missing tillage.

进一步的,为了满足不同农艺的要求,所述开沟器机架上还设有第二开沟链轮和传动链条。所述第二开沟链轮安装在开沟器机架上,其安装位置比第一开沟链轮高,位于动力输入轴与第一开沟链轮之间。所述第二开沟链轮通过传动链条与动力输入轴连接,具体的,所述传动链条分别连接第二主动链轮和第二开沟链轮,当动力输入轴转动时,可以直接带动第二开沟链轮转动。由于第二开沟链轮的安装位置比第一开沟链轮高,因此将第一开沟刀片安装在第二开沟链轮上时,可以开出两边高中间低的梯形沟槽,以便在不同土壤层施肥或进行其他要求阶梯沟的作业。Further, in order to meet the requirements of different agricultural techniques, the frame of the ditch opener is further provided with a second ditching sprocket and a transmission chain. The second ditching sprocket is installed on the opener frame at a higher installation position than the first ditching sprocket and between the power input shaft and the first ditching sprocket. The second ditching sprocket is connected to the power input shaft through a transmission chain. Specifically, the transmission chain is respectively connected to the second driving sprocket and the second ditching sprocket. When the power input shaft rotates, it can directly drive the first ditching sprocket. Two ditching sprockets rotate. Since the installation position of the second ditching sprocket is higher than that of the first ditching sprocket, when the first ditching blade is installed on the second ditching sprocket, a trapezoidal groove with high sides and low middle can be opened, so that Applying fertilizers in different soil layers or other operations requiring stepped trenches.

作为本发明的优选方案,为了拓展开沟器的更多用途,提高设备的通用性,降低农民的购机成本。所述第一开沟链轮上还设有可拆卸的刀盘装置,所述刀盘装置安装在第一开沟链轮上,与第一开沟链轮传动连接。所述刀盘装置主要包括与第一开沟链轮传动连接的花键轴、连接第一开沟链轮和花键轴的花键轴套、以及开沟刀盘。所述花键轴穿过第一开沟链轮,通过花键轴套与第一开沟链轮传动连接。所述开沟刀盘固定在花键轴的端部,所述第一开沟刀片安装在开沟刀盘上。由于刀盘装置设计成可拆卸结构,因此,只需将第一开沟链轮一侧的刀盘装置拆卸下来,安装到第二开沟链轮的一侧上即可开出深度不同的阶梯沟,刀盘装置的拆卸和安装步骤简单、操作方便,采用该结构的设备可以实现一机多用,可以有效降低购买设备的成本。As a preferred solution of the present invention, in order to expand more uses of the ditch opener, improve the versatility of the equipment, and reduce the purchase cost of farmers. A detachable cutter head device is also provided on the first ditching sprocket, and the cutter head device is installed on the first ditching sprocket and connected with the first ditching sprocket in transmission. The cutterhead device mainly includes a spline shaft connected to the first ditching sprocket, a spline bushing connecting the first ditching sprocket and the spline shaft, and a ditching cutterhead. The spline shaft passes through the first ditching sprocket, and is connected with the first ditching sprocket through a spline sleeve. The ditching cutter head is fixed on the end of the spline shaft, and the first ditching blade is installed on the ditching cutter head. Since the cutter head device is designed as a detachable structure, it is only necessary to remove the cutter head device on the side of the first ditching sprocket and install it on the side of the second ditching sprocket to create steps with different depths The disassembly and installation steps of the cutter head device are simple and easy to operate. The equipment with this structure can realize one machine with multiple functions, which can effectively reduce the cost of purchasing equipment.

作为本发明的优选方案,所述每个开沟刀盘上安装四片第一开沟刀片。As a preferred solution of the present invention, four first ditching blades are installed on each ditching cutter head.

作为本发明的优选方案,为了使第一开沟链轮的动力输出有效输送给第一刀片进行开沟作业,所述花键轴与花键套之间、花键轴与开沟刀盘之间通过定位销连接。采用定位销连接后,可以固定第一开沟链轮与花键轴、花键轴套和开沟刀盘的位置,减轻开沟时产生的抖动,提高动力的有效输出。As a preferred solution of the present invention, in order to effectively transmit the power output of the first ditching sprocket to the first blade for ditching operation, between the spline shaft and the spline sleeve, between the spline shaft and the ditching cutter head, are connected by positioning pins. After being connected with the positioning pin, the positions of the first ditching sprocket, the spline shaft, the spline shaft sleeve and the ditching cutter head can be fixed, the vibration generated during ditching can be reduced, and the effective output of power can be improved.

作为本发明的优选方案,由于第二开沟刀片需要对中间部分的土壤进行切土作业,因此,所述第二开沟刀片采用链式开沟刀片(形状如钩形),第二开沟刀片之间间隔设置在开沟链条上,而且背向向外延伸。在切土时,L形的链式开沟刀片将中间的土壤切片后撒向两边,而位于两边的第一开沟刀片在开沟时,会将这部分土壤与开沟产生的土壤一同撒向沟槽的两边。As a preferred solution of the present invention, since the second ditching blade needs to carry out soil cutting operations to the soil in the middle part, the second ditching blade adopts a chain type ditching blade (shaped as a hook), and the second ditching blade The blades are arranged at intervals on the ditching chain, and extend back to the outside. When cutting the soil, the L-shaped chain ditching blade slices the soil in the middle and spreads it to both sides, while the first ditching blade on both sides will spread this part of the soil together with the soil produced by the ditching to both sides of the trench.

作为本发明的优选方案,由于开沟器在开沟时会翻起很多泥土,部分泥土会进入开沟器的传动部件中,造成开沟器卡住、部件损坏等情况,因此,所述动力输入轴上还设有用于挡土的罩壳,所述罩壳安装在开沟器机架上,将动力输入轴罩住。罩壳的设计可以有效阻挡泥土和碎石进入动力输入轴,极大地降低了动力输入轴发生故障的概率,减轻开沟器的维护成本,延长使用寿命。As a preferred solution of the present invention, since the opener will turn up a lot of soil when ditching, part of the soil will enter the transmission parts of the opener, causing the opener to be stuck and parts damaged. Therefore, the power The input shaft is also provided with a casing for retaining soil, and the casing is installed on the opener frame to cover the power input shaft. The design of the casing can effectively prevent mud and gravel from entering the power input shaft, which greatly reduces the probability of failure of the power input shaft, reduces the maintenance cost of the opener, and prolongs the service life.

本发明的工作过程和原理是:本发明通过动力输入轴带动第一开沟链轮转动,使安装在第一开沟链轮两侧的第一开沟刀片转动,对位于开沟器两边的土壤进行开沟。在位于开沟器中部的开沟链条上安装有第二开沟刀片,第二开沟刀片采用链式开沟刀片,间隔地安装在开沟链条上,第二开沟刀片对开沟器中部进行开沟作业,从而避免漏耕的情况出现。另外,本发明还在第一开沟链轮的上方设置第二开沟链轮,将刀盘装置设计成可拆卸的部件,当需要开阶梯沟时,将刀盘装置拆下来安装在第二开沟链轮上即可,操作十分方便。本发明的结构简单、制造成本较低,而且可以实现一机多用。The working process and principle of the present invention are: the present invention drives the first ditching sprocket to rotate through the power input shaft, so that the first ditching blades installed on both sides of the first ditching sprocket rotate, The soil is ditched. A second ditching blade is installed on the ditching chain located in the middle of the ditcher. The second ditching blade adopts chain type ditching blades and is installed on the ditching chain at intervals. Carry out ditching operations to avoid missing tillage. In addition, the present invention also sets the second ditching sprocket above the first ditching sprocket, and the cutter head device is designed as a detachable part. The ditching sprocket can be used, and the operation is very convenient. The invention has simple structure, low manufacturing cost, and can realize multiple functions of one machine.
